About VeoliaVeolia is a global leader in environmental services, operating across all five continents with nearly 218,000 employees. Specializing in water, energy, and waste management, Veolia Group designs and implements innovative solutions for decarbonization, depollution, and resource regeneration, supporting communities and industries in their ecological transformation. Within this framework, Veolia's Water Technology Business brings together a dedicated team of experienced professionals committed to tackling the world's most complex challenges related to water scarcity, quality, productivity, and energy. Together, we pursue a shared mission to create a more sustainable future.Job SummaryThe EHS Manager is responsible for directly supporting our manufacturing operations with all environmental, health, and safety elements for the manufacturing operations at Boulder, CO, and for the North American field and remote employees. They will also assist the local EHS organizations in the countries where our Analytical Instruments are manufactured (Hungary, China, India, etc.) to ensure we are providing a safe work environment for our employees and contractors.The EHS Manager will also manage our Supply Chain Technical Writer and Training Coordinator.Key CharacteristicsPassion for environmental, health, and safety-related mattersEnthusiastic trainerOrganized and attentive to detailsSelf-motivatedKey ResponsibilitiesManage EHS employee engagement activities and provide leadership to programs that instill a safety-first mindset, as well as ensure complianceAnalyze data to proactively assess health and safety challenges, and to develop approaches to control risks; monitor and document EHS activities and corrective action plans to completionInitiate, improve, and lead the integration of EHS policies, programs, and practices into the business; ensure all employee and contractor training is completed, documented, and maintainedManage activities, which drive compliance with all applicable federal, state, local, and corporate EHS laws, regulations, policies, and guidelines; maintain expert knowledge of existing and proposed regulationsSupport the Management of Change Program, by participating in critical business reviews and conducting safety inspectionsOversee our OSHA Voluntary Protection Program, as well as host internal and governmental audits and inspectionsQualificationsAt least 7 years of experience in EHS management at a manufacturing facilityCertified Safety Professional (preferred)Experience implementing EHS programs and achieving measurable goals, with exempt and nonexempt employeesAbility to lead change, work in a fast pace environment and operate independently to deliver business resultsExperience working with local, state, and federal regulatory agencies, including environmental applications and renewalsExperience developing and implementing programs to drive employee engagement in and ownership of EHSPrior operational experience of business continuity planning and incident managementAbility to work with remote cross‑functional and cross‑cultural teamsEffective communication skills (verbal, written, and listening)Applicants must be eligible to lawfully work in the U.S. immediately; employer will not sponsor U.S. work authorization (e.g., H‑1B visa)Education & ExperienceBachelor's Degree from an accredited university or college, preferably in Occupational Health and Safety, Chemistry, Industrial Engineering, or Environmental ScienceAdditional InformationCompensation – $100,000 - $135,000 USD (depending on individual candidate knowledge, skills, experience, and market conditions)Life InsurancePaid Time OffPaid HolidaysFlexible Spending & Health Saving AccountsAD&D InsuranceDisability InsuranceTuition ReimbursementEEO StatementAll your information will be kept confidential according to EEO guidelines.
